Abstract

The utility model proposes a kind of information collecting device, including:The first connectivity port being connected with the first equipment and the second connection end mouth being connected with the second equipment;First connectivity port further includes:With the first contact and the linked switching device of the second contact portion;Linked switching device, for according to current gear, controlling first object connection terminal corresponding with current gear and the first contact portion and control the second target connection terminal corresponding with current gear and the second contact portion;First connectivity port for corresponding to the job information of the first equipment of acquisition according to the connection terminal of current gear, and is transferred to second connection end mouth;Second connection end mouth is sent to the second equipment for receiving job information.The operation range by adjusting switching device realizes the conversion to the information gathering circuit of relevant device as a result, improves the efficiency of information gathering, avoids when building different acquisition circuits due to equipment loss caused by the plug of pluggable terminals repeatedly.

Background technology
With the development of Information and Communication Technology, the function increasingly diversification of information collecting device, multifunctional information acquisition Equipment can be converted to gather different types of information as desired by converter, then be transmitted by communications protocol Information data.For example, car OBD interface can be each to gather automobile speed, temperature, engine torque etc. with the stitch of crossover sub It plants data and passes through CAN bus and send information in corresponding controller.
In correlation technique, the converter of information collecting device is made of multiple conversion heads, needs to insert repeatedly during use Pull out the conversion that converter plug is acquired function.This scheme is not only cumbersome, and often connecting-disconnecting interface terminal is easy Plug terminal is caused to be damaged or even can influence the acquisition of information.

A kind of structure diagram for information collecting device circuit that Fig. 1 is provided by the utility model embodiment.
As shown in Figure 1, the information collecting device includes:It the first connectivity port 1 for being connected with the first equipment and is set with second The second connection end mouth 2 of standby connection.Wherein, the first equipment is the equipment of information to be collected, can be vehicle, production equipment, machine Tool equipment etc..Second equipment can be received the information of acquisition and handle the controller of information, detecting instrument etc., so as to this reality With new information collecting device, the first equipment is connected to by the first connectivity port 1, and the information of acquisition is connected via second It connects port 2 and is transferred to the second equipment, and then, the information collected can be handled by the second equipment, analyzed.This practicality is new The application scenarios such as the information collecting device of type can be applied to vehicle diagnosis, program is write with a brush dipped in Chinese ink, maintenance of equipment.
Wherein, with continued reference to Fig. 1, the first connectivity port 1 includes the first contact 12, logical of connection terminal 11, communication bus Believe the second contact of bus 13.Wherein, connection terminal 11 includes and 12 corresponding first group of terminal 111, Yi Jiyu of the first contact Second contact, 13 corresponding second group of terminal 112.
Wherein, the quantity of the function of connection terminal 11, arrangement architecture and terminal is related to test application field, for example, When information collecting device is applied to automobile diagnosis technique field, the arrangement mode and number of terminals of connection terminal 11 are examined with automobile Disconnector corresponds to.
It should be appreciated that above-mentioned communication bus can be all kinds of buses for being used for transmission information, such as RS-485 buses, IEEE-488 bus, CAN bus etc. in the present embodiment, pass through communication bus two connectivity port information and dates of realization It exchanges.In practical implementation, communication bus is divided into high pressure and low-voltage circuit, for example for CAN bus etc., is divided into CAN high Line and the low lines of CAN in the present embodiment, the exchange of two connectivity port information and dates, associated are realized by communication bus Connecting terminal realizes building and then convenient for according to the acquisition for information gathering circuit by the connection respectively with high pressure and low-voltage circuit Circuit completes the acquisition of related work information, wherein, in the embodiment of the utility model, it is total that the first contact 12 corresponds to communication The high-tension line of line, the second contact 13 corresponds to the low-voltage circuit of communication bus or, the second contact 13 corresponds to communication bus Low-voltage circuit, the first contact 12 correspond to the low-voltage circuit of communication bus.
Specifically, in the embodiment of the utility model, a terminal that connection terminal 11 passes through first group of terminal 111 It is connected with the first contact 12, is connected by second group of terminal 112 with the second contact 13, wherein, according to the work of information collecting device Make principle, first group of terminal 111 and second group of terminal 112 are corresponded and set, wherein, first group of terminal 111 and second group of end Different corresponding combinations, can correspond to the acquisition function to the different information of the first equipment, for example, first group of end between son 112 The correspondence of son 111 and second group of terminal 112 is shown in the following table 1, then the first contacts of terminal a1 12 in first terminal 111 connects It connects, when the terminal b3 in second group of terminal 112 is connected with the second contact 13, the corresponding information gathering work(of current information collecting device Can be C1, then current information equipment acquisition is information corresponding with C1 functions in the first equipment.

As shown in figure 3, in second connection end mouth 2 include with the one-to-one connection terminal of 1 terminal of the first connectivity port, by This, is connected to the objective terminal of communication bus in connection terminal 11, in the connection terminal that can be given in second connection end mouth 2 To mapping, that is, second connection end 21 directly at the corresponding ports of the first connectivity port 1, obtains the first connectivity port The job information of 1 the first equipment got, certainly, in this example, the tools such as second equipment that second connection end mouth 2 is connected There is jointing corresponding with the connection terminal in second connection end mouth 2.
For example, when the first equipment is vehicle, communication bus is CAN bus, the first connectivity port 1 passes through vehicle The job information of vehicle diagnostics plug collection vehicle, then in this example, the first connectivity port 1 is matched with car OBD interface 16 pin OBD plugs of standard trapezoid, OBD plugs include protocol bus pin, communication bus pin, quotation marks wire pin etc., first Connectivity port 1 can gather the devices such as the engine, emission control systems, fuel system of automobile in real time by the OBD plugs Job information, and then, as shown in figure 4, the work state information of the vehicle collected is sent to via second connection end mouth 2 In information collecting device, wherein, when the job information difference of acquisition, realized by linked switching device 14 and currently inserted with OBD Head corresponding terminal connection connection terminal switching and connection, you can complete, avoid repeatedly OBD plugs plug with currently adopting The corresponding acquisition circuit of job information of collection.

Based on above description, it is to be understood that due in the prior art, in order to obtain the job information of Devices to test, It needs to connect the corresponding interface position of the corresponding conversion head of information collecting device and Devices to test, when needing to test different works , it is necessary to which the conversion head connected before is pulled out when making information, the job information pair with currently testing is inserted into corresponding interface position The conversion head answered, so as to which this test mode plugged repeatedly is easy to cause loss of the terminal of plug etc..
And in the utility model, the terminal of the test function comprising various job informations is arranged on first port 1 simultaneously In, so as to, terminal corresponding with current job information to be tested is switched to by switching device 14 and is connected with communication bus, Test loop is formed, if the corresponding terminal of the job information currently tested terminal corresponding with the job information that last time tests is not Together, then the switching that terminal can be realized in operation switching device 14 is needed only to, without plug, avoids equipment loss.
Wherein, switching device 14 can be arranged on the first connectivity port 1 according to production technology, can also be arranged on On two connectivity ports 2, this is not restricted, and switching device 14 can include multi-functional change-over switch of double-pole etc. and there is linkage to cut The device of function is changed, and in practical implementation, for the ease of the operation of related technical personnel, switching device 14 can include Handle is rotated, i.e., as shown in fig. 6, when switching device 14 is located on second connection end mouth 2, technical staff can be somebody's turn to do by rotation The operation range that handle extremely needs is rotated, to control the operation range of the multi-functional change-over switch of double-pole, wherein, different work shelves Position corresponds to different connection terminals, wherein, in order to intuitively be shown to the connecting pin of each operation range connection of technology human eye Son, as shown in fig. 6, the corresponding connection terminal of each operation range can also be shown, wherein, each operation range corresponds to Number be the connection terminal that is correspondingly connected with of work at present gear.
